Forest Therapy

Returned to the wooded place I shed tears
where speaking out loud without any fears
had no shame or guilt attached to the spew
birds deer fairies fae gathered by the few
looking on from afar allowing my release
so I can continue my self-healing in peace
it was therapy for my soul without any pay
evaluating how far I have come along today
sound of an ovation of clapping oak leaves
spiders appeared showcases web weaves
feeling appreciated never a moment before
time to leave because there's more to explore
this wooded place I will never ever forget
remembering it will be my perfect outlet
arrived with pain left with tremendous grace
how could I ever forget this imperfect place
